Most commercial HVAC systems last 15 to 20 years, but that’s assuming they’re maintained properly. In Texas, where you’re running AC almost constantly and dealing with extreme heat and humidity, a neglected system might only make it 10 to 12 years.

The lifespan depends on a few things: how often the system is serviced, how hard it’s working, and whether small problems get fixed before they become big ones. A system that’s cleaned and inspected regularly will outlast one that’s ignored until something breaks.

If your system is approaching 15 years old and you’re starting to see frequent repairs, it might be time to talk about replacement. We’ll be honest with you about whether it makes sense to keep repairing or if you’re throwing money at a system that’s on its way out. Sometimes the math says fix it. Sometimes it says replace it. We’ll walk you through both options.

Preventive maintenance catches problems before they become emergencies. That means fewer breakdowns, lower energy bills, and a system that lasts longer.

Here’s what actually happens during a maintenance visit: we clean the system, check refrigerant levels, inspect electrical connections, test controls, and look for anything that’s wearing out or about to fail. It’s not glamorous, but it works. Businesses with regular maintenance programs see about 30% less downtime and 20% lower energy costs compared to businesses that only call when something breaks.

For commercial HVAC in Windcrest, TX, where your system is working hard almost year-round, maintenance isn’t optional if you want to avoid expensive surprises. We schedule visits around your business hours, and most maintenance appointments take less than two hours. It’s a small investment that saves you a lot more in avoided repairs and energy waste.
